Transaction 59e6155f28349259f992e4c60932d13d00f764858e15c7bf89a9edbf2b7363f8
1 Input
1 Output
-
59e6155f28349259f992e4c60932d13d00f764858e15c7bf89a9edbf2b7363f8:0
- value
- 30000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b9302ee50150c61163b4923e98b32a020e6f59e OP_EQUAL
- address
- 3QdDeEALLa4pdhMbBfVtbuMxWQQN1JWC4M